## Step 4: Switch traffic to the green billing worker

Drain the blue pool for Ledgerhop's billing worker. Confirm zero in-flight invoices, then flip the router alias to green. Do not scale blue down until reconciliation passes. Green must start with the exact settings used during the rehearsal. Apply the configuration below before flipping the alias.

deployment values, yadug-bawif:
[framir]
team = pelox
access_code = ac_a38ab2
owner = tamion.julael
host = framir.tolvaqlabs.test
port = 11211
peer = tammir.zemvargrid.local
salt = 2215ef03
pin = 1541

### Account Recovery — Catalogue Import (Lintwood)

Quick one for review: when the Lintwood catalogue import wipes a patron's session table, the recovery flow re-seeds accounts from the nightly snapshot. Check that the importer skips locked accounts — last time it didn't. To rerun recovery against staging you'll need the vault passphrase, which is appended just below.

recovery phrase for yafof-tajof: julmir-kelax-julvan-holath-belvan-holir-ralael-ralvan-ralath-julvan-silmir-istmir-kaswyn-ulamir

**Q: What is our dependency pinning policy?**

All production services at Marrowvale pin exact versions in the lockfile; version ranges are not permitted in manifests. Automated bumps run every Tuesday and require a passing integration suite before merge. Security patches may bypass the schedule with a lead's approval. New team members should read the full policy, documented at the internal page below.

wiki page, bagaf-fawip: https://harbor.tolvaqsys.local/pages/repo/pages/secrets/eac969ffc71f356b

A: Non-hermetic builds pulled toolchains from developer machines, making provenance unverifiable. Lattermill now pins all compilers, sysroots, and third-party deps by digest inside the Fenwick sandbox. Network access is blocked at build time; any fetch fails the job. Reproducibility is checked nightly by rebuilding and diffing artifacts. Audit logs live in the Corvane registry. The sealed signing key for the migration rollback bundle is protected by a passphrase, recorded below.

unlock words, yawig-kagef: gordor-holvan-ulaael-pramir-ulaiel-tamdor